In what situation might a backup camera be utilized during sewer inspections?

Explanation:
The utilization of a backup camera during sewer inspections is most relevant when the main camera is malfunctioning. In situations where the primary camera is compromised—whether due to technical issues, damage, or a failure to provide a clear view—having a backup camera ensures that inspections can continue without interruption. Backup cameras serve as a reliable alternative to gather critical information and assess the condition of sewer lines, thus maintaining the integrity of the inspection process. This scenario underscores the importance of having contingency plans and equipment that allow for ongoing operations and effective maintenance of sewer systems. Routine inspections, nighttime inspections, and inspecting above-ground lines typically do not specifically necessitate the use of a backup camera; these situations are usually manageable with standard inspection equipment unless coupled with unforeseen technical difficulties.
